Just remember, Fast Wireless Charging is not as fast as Fast Charging on a wired charger (it's actually closer to a 'normal' wired charger). So don't think you'll get super fast charging with this one.

well from fast wirless charging stand it will full charge in about 2 hours, 20 mins. Which isn't far off what the iphone takes. on the cable will take 1 hour, 15 mins roughly.

If you are in no hurry to charge your device use the charging stand...like when you are sleeping over night but if it's needed quickly you use the cable

The phone stops with it plugged in also.

The advantage is mainly convenience, and you are not putting wear and tear on the charging port.
